 Thank you all for the help! Sorry I haven't gotten to check this until now we've been pounding the pavement checking mileage, etc!  We have looked at close to 20 properties since Monday!!  I apologize for not putting the area specifics- we are measuring the distance to the Will Rogers airport as the criteria as the distance that hubby will be driving daily.  We currently don't have any horses that will be moving with us for awhile but have 2 dogs & lots of stuff! The renting for alittle bit maybe the way we will need to go but it will have to be Month to month while we house search.  

We will be using a VA loan so that has to meet certain criteria.  We did find something we like everything but the distance.  It's about 35 miles = 42 minutes without traffic so we are trying to see if we want to sacrifice more true country living for gas mileage!  It seems OKC area is very built up in all directions.  Several places even had HOA & no livestock!!

 Many people don't realize how much land in Oklahoma is becoming zoned as residential, but not agricultural. So much land being sold has HOA rules, fees, or both with limits on livestock if any allowed at all. They are regulated what type of home and buildings you can put on the property as well. It's like they've forgotten they are "in the country". People who want to live in the country, but not really.

 We haven't had any issues regarding acreage for a VA loan but we haven't used it for that yet!  Our realtor said that's not a problem but it can't be "as is" condition.  We looked at some that my not pass an inspection which means VA won't finance.  I don't think it will let you get into any fore closures either.
